Subject: bug#24758: 26.0.50; speedbar broken in -nw

> >From -Q -nw, just do M-x speedbar. The message buffer is filled with:
>
> tty-create-frame-with-faces: Can’t change the ‘minibuffer’ parameter of
> this frameInval\
> id face reference: font-lock-comment-delimiter-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-delimiter-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-face
> Invalid face reference: mode-line-buffer-id
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-delimiter-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-delimiter-face
> Invalid face reference: font-lock-comment-face
> Invalid face reference: mode-line-buffer-id
> <snip>
Martin, can you take a look? I think the first error message above is
the key to the problem. It only happens on master.
